sql数据库什么是选择查询
-
在SQL数据库中,选择查询(SELECT)是一种用于从数据库中检索特定数据的查询语句。选择查询是SQL语言中最常用和最基本的查询类型之一。它允许用户从一个或多个表中选择指定的列和行,以满足特定的查询条件。
以下是选择查询的一些重要概念和用法:
-
选择特定的列:使用SELECT语句可以指定要检索的列。例如,SELECT column1, column2 FROM table; 将返回表中指定列的数据。
-
选择所有的列:使用SELECT *语句可以选择所有的列。例如,SELECT * FROM table; 将返回表中所有列的数据。
-
使用WHERE子句过滤行:使用WHERE子句可以指定查询的条件,只返回满足条件的行。例如,SELECT * FROM table WHERE column1 = 'value'; 将返回满足条件column1等于'value'的行。
-
使用DISTINCT关键字去重:使用DISTINCT关键字可以去除查询结果中的重复行。例如,SELECT DISTINCT column1 FROM table; 将返回指定列中的唯一值。
-
使用ORDER BY子句排序结果:使用ORDER BY子句可以按照指定的列对查询结果进行排序。例如,SELECT * FROM table ORDER BY column1 ASC; 将按照升序对列column1进行排序。
-
使用LIMIT子句限制结果数量:使用LIMIT子句可以限制查询结果的数量。例如,SELECT * FROM table LIMIT 10; 将返回前10行的结果。
-
使用JOIN操作连接多个表:使用JOIN操作可以将多个表进行连接,以检索相关的数据。例如,SELECT * FROM table1 JOIN table2 ON table1.column1 = table2.column2; 将返回table1和table2中符合连接条件的数据。
选择查询是SQL中最基本和常用的查询方式之一,它提供了灵活的条件和功能,使用户能够从数据库中获取所需的数据。通过熟练掌握选择查询的语法和用法,可以轻松地检索和处理数据库中的数据。
1年前 -
-
在SQL数据库中,选择查询(SELECT)是一种用于从数据库中检索数据的操作。选择查询允许我们指定要检索的表、列以及任何过滤条件,以获得满足特定条件的数据集。
选择查询的基本语法如下:
SELECT 列1, 列2, ... FROM 表名 WHERE 条件;其中,SELECT关键字指定要检索的列,可以是单个列、多个列,或者使用通配符
*表示所有列。FROM关键字指定要从中检索数据的表名。WHERE子句用于指定过滤条件,只返回满足条件的数据。例如,假设我们有一个名为"students"的表,包含学生的姓名、年龄和分数等信息。如果我们想要检索所有学生的姓名和年龄,可以使用以下选择查询:
SELECT 姓名, 年龄 FROM students;如果我们只想检索年龄大于等于18岁的学生,可以使用以下选择查询:
SELECT 姓名, 年龄 FROM students WHERE 年龄 >= 18;选择查询还可以使用其他关键字和操作符来实现更复杂的条件过滤。例如,可以使用AND、OR和NOT等逻辑操作符来组合多个条件,使用LIKE关键字进行模糊匹配,使用ORDER BY关键字对结果进行排序等。
总而言之,选择查询是SQL数据库中用于检索数据的重要操作,它允许我们根据特定条件从数据库中选择所需的数据,并以所需的格式进行返回。
1年前 -
选择查询是一种SQL语句,用于从数据库表中选择特定的行和列数据。选择查询是SQL中最常用的查询类型之一,它允许用户根据特定的条件从一个或多个表中检索数据。
选择查询语句的基本语法如下:
SELECT 列名1, 列名2, ... FROM 表名 WHERE 条件;其中,SELECT关键字用于指定要选择的列,可以选择多列,用逗号分隔。FROM关键字用于指定要查询的表名。WHERE关键字用于指定查询的条件,只有符合条件的行才会被选择出来。
下面是一个具体的例子,假设有一个名为"students"的表,包含了学生的姓名、年龄和成绩信息:
CREATE TABLE students ( id INT PRIMARY KEY, name VARCHAR(50), age INT, score INT ); INSERT INTO students (id, name, age, score) VALUES (1, '张三', 20, 80), (2, '李四', 21, 90), (3, '王五', 22, 85);现在我们想要查询成绩大于80分的学生的姓名和年龄,可以使用以下SQL语句:
SELECT name, age FROM students WHERE score > 80;运行以上查询语句,将返回满足条件的学生的姓名和年龄:
+------+-----+ | name | age | +------+-----+ | 李四 | 21 | | 王五 | 22 | +------+-----+除了基本的选择查询语法,还可以使用一些其他的关键字和语法来进一步定制查询结果,例如使用ORDER BY关键字对结果进行排序,使用LIMIT关键字限制返回的行数等。
总结起来,选择查询是一种常用的SQL查询语句,用于从数据库表中选择特定的行和列数据。通过指定要选择的列、要查询的表和查询的条件,可以得到符合条件的数据结果。
1年前